About the Role
We are currently recruiting for experienced Electrical Technicians on behalf of our client operating in the Oil & Gas sector.
This is a fantastic opportunity for skilled Electrical Technicians looking for a secure, long-term temporary contract. You will play a key role in assembling, wiring, and testing specialised control panels engineered for high-spec energy and industrial applications.
Key Responsibilities:
Point-to-point wiring, assembly, and integration of control panels to exact client specs and safety standards.
Interpret electrical schematics, engineering drawings, and layout diagrams accurately.
Fit relays, PLCs, terminal blocks, circuit breakers, and associated hardware.
Carry out initial electrical inspections, continuity checks, and fault-finding prior to testing.
Ensure all work adheres strictly to Oil & Gas industry compliance, safety regulations, and quality controls.
What We Are Looking For:
Proven experience as an Electrical Technician with a strong background in control panel building.
Previous experience within Oil & Gas, subsea or heavy engineering is desirable.
Relevant recognised electrical qualification, NVQ or City and Guilds with working experience.
Initially working on a dayshift pattern, but must be willing and flexible to transition onto a day/night shift rotation as project demands increase.
